Reach Foundation is our alternative provision for early years and primary- aged children, offering a supportive and inclusive environment tailored to individual needs. We help children access education in a way that works for them, with a focus on reintegration into mainstream school where possible. Where needed, we also support transitions into specialist provision to ensure the best outcomes.
